Storage: Keep the tuna salad in an airtight container in the fridge for 3-4 days.
-
Substitutions: Greek yogurt can be used instead of mayonnaise for a protein boost.
-
Low-Carb Options: Serve in lettuce wraps, avocado halves, or cucumber slices instead of bread.
-
Variations: Add chopped hard-boiled eggs, diced pickles, capers, fresh dill, or sliced almonds for extra flavor.
-
Serving Suggestion: Toasted and buttered bread enhances texture and taste when making a sandwich.
